服务器回收与搭建:一个被低估的决策点
2026年年中,当大多数技术团队还在为云服务的账单发愁时,一个被反复提起的话题是:那些被淘汰的物理服务器,比如罗湖老旧机房里的设备,到底还有没有价值?上周我去深圳罗湖拜访了一家做游戏服务器框架的老牌公司,他们的CTO直言,回收这些服务器并不只是为了卖废铁,而是能从中拆解出不少还能用的硬件,用于搭建内部测试环境。这让我意识到,在讨论任何高端技术之前,先把屁股底下的硬件搞清楚,可能才是正事。
搭建SS服务器:不只是翻墙那么简单
很多人一提到“搭建ss服务器教程”,脑子里浮现的就是绕过审查、访问外网。但站在2026年的现实来看,Shadowsocks这类协议早已超出了最初的用途。我身边不少开发者用它来加密自己的本地开发流量,避免在公共Wi-Fi下被中间人攻击。更实际的是,当你需要远程连接到公司内网的服务器,但公司出于安全考虑只开放了特定端口时,一个自建的SS隧道往往比VPN更轻量、更可靠。
所以别再只盯着“教程”两个字。搭建的关键在于三个环节:选择隐蔽性好的端口(比如443或8080)、配置强加密算法(推荐chacha20-ietf-poly1305)、以及搞定UDP转发(这对游戏服务器很重要)。别用那些一键脚本,手动操作虽然麻烦,但能让你真正理解每个参数的作用。我见过太多人图省事,结果服务器被扫描出来成了肉鸡。
网游服务器框架:选对技术栈,后面就顺了
前阵子一个做独立游戏的朋友问我,为什么他的MMO手游一开服就卡,逻辑帧掉到10以下。聊下来发现他用的是最基础的Socket线程模型,每个连接开一个线程,几千人同时在线直接爆炸。关于游戏服务器,一个老生常谈但又总被忽略的事实是:框架决定了你能抗多少并发。
2026年的主流选择已经非常明确:基于Actor模型的框架(如Akka、Pomelo)或者基于事件驱动+协程的方案(Go语言+Leaf框架)。不要迷信C++,除非你的团队有十年以上的C++经验。Java/Go搭配Netty或者KCP协议,已经能处理几万人的同时在线。更重要的是,一定要考虑状态同步和帧同步的取舍。如果你的游戏是格斗或RTS类,帧同步要求客户端和服务器的时间误差在毫秒级,这在物理服务器上容易实现,但在云服务器上因为虚拟化开销,反而容易出问题。
远程桌面连接不到服务器:别慌,先查这四个地方
“远程桌面连接不到服务器”可能是每个运维最讨厌的报错。我最近在一次测试中就遇到了,花了半小时才找到原因。这里分享一个排查流程:
- 第一步,ping一下服务器IP,如果不通,大概率是网络问题或防火墙阻挡。
- 第二步,检查远程桌面服务是否在运行(Windows下是TermService)。
- 第三步,确认端口是否被占用或改变,默认是3389,很多安全策略会改成别的端口。
- 第四步,看系统日志,有没有不明来源的登录失败尝试。2026年针对RDP的暴力破解仍然猖獗,建议启用网络级别身份验证(NLA)。
有一次我发现问题出在本地DNS缓存,清理一下立刻恢复了。另一个常见坑是云服务商的安全组规则,更新后忘了放行端口。所以,永远先看控制台。
罗湖服务器回收:一个被忽视的硬件循环
回到开头说的罗湖服务器回收。我在那里见到不少中小企业,他们把用了五年的Xeon E5机器卖给回收商,结果回收商重新组装后,低价卖给了那些需要做深度学习推理的创业公司。为什么呢?因为这些老机器的PCIe通道多,可以插多块GPU卡,虽然单核性能不强,但并行跑任务反而划算。如果你也在考虑怎么处理淘汰的硬件,别急着当废品处理,可以先问问本地做渲染或AI推理的团队。
结尾:技术决策从来不只是技术问题
回头看这几件事,搭建SS服务器、选游戏服务器框架、处理远程连接故障、甚至回收旧设备,每一条都涉及权衡。没有哪个方案是完美的,但多问几个为什么,多从实际场景出发,远比照着教程敲命令更有意义。希望这些经验能让你少走些弯路。